Atlatsa, a platinum group metals mining, exploration and development company, posted a 19 percent increase in revenue to R53.8 million despite production challenges in the three months to March, the firm reported yesterday. This comes as the Bokoni mine continued to demonstrate a positive trend in operating performance, the company said. Production was negatively affected by the safety stoppages imposed by the Department of Mineral Resources, and rainfall across the northern part of the country during the quarter, the company said. It added that the heaviest rainfall in the past twenty years was recorded at Bokoni mine. “These conditions had a negative impact on the Klipfontein open cast mine, which managed to produce only 50 percent of its planned production volumes”. – Dineo Faku
